Jesus, the Alpha and Omega, tells his persecuted church that “He who overcomes will inherit all this, and I will be his God and he will be my son” (Revelation 21:7 NIV). And then says something hard to accept.
PERSPECTIVE
“But the cowardly, the unbelieving, the vile, the murders, the sexually immoral, those who practice magic arts, the idolaters and all liars—their place will be in the fiery lake of burning sulfur. This is the second death” (Revelation 21:8 NIV).
STRENGTH FOR THE JOURNEY
It’s not hard to believe these people deserve the fiery lake. But to start the list with the cowardly? And even include the cowardly in the list with these horrible people? When the Christians hearing these words are already being persecuted?
Perhaps standing up for Christ against a perverse culture means more to our King than we want to think.
